Al-Ra'i Meets with Minister of Economy and Industry

Al-Ra'i Meets with Minister of Economy and Industry

Saba Yemen27-05-2025

Sana'a (Saba) – Parliament Speaker Yahya Ali Al-Ra'i met today with the Minister of Economy, Industry, and Investment, Eng. Maeen Al-Mahaqri, and the Chairman of the Yemeni Cement Manufacturing and Marketing Corporation, Yahya Atifa.
During the meeting, the Parliament Speaker heard from the Minister of Economy and Industry an explanation of the ministry's and the corporation's efforts to confront the repercussions of the US-Israeli aggression targeting the economic infrastructure.

Jihad says aggression on southern suburb of Beirut blatant assault with blatant American cover

Gaza – Saba: The Islamic Jihad Movement in Palestine has condemned the Israeli aggression on the southern suburb of Beirut on the eve of Eid al-Adha. In a press statement, Jihad said "The treacherous Zionist aggression that targeted residential areas in the southern suburbs of Beirut and areas in southern Lebanon, resulting in widespread destruction, terrorizing innocent civilians, and forcing thousands of families to flee their homes on the eve of Eid al-Adha, constitutes a violation of the ceasefire, which the enemy has never observed, with blatant American cover and complicity." It considered this attack "a blatant provocation and confirmation of premeditated aggressive intentions aimed at dragging Lebanon into a dangerous escalation through which the enemy seeks to expand and consolidate its occupation." The movement said, "While we pray to God to protect Lebanon and its people from all harm, we affirm the depth of the fraternal relations that unite the Lebanese and Palestinian peoples in the face of these attacks." Photojournalist dies from wounds after Israeli enemy shelling of journalists' tent in Gaza

Gaza – Saba: Photojournalist Ahmed Qalajah died this Friday morning from wounds sustained in a previous Israeli shelling. The Palestinian Wafa News Agency reported that Israeli enemy warplanes had bombed the journalists' tent at the Baptist Hospital in Gaza on Thursday . That attack killed three journalists – Ismail Badah, Suleiman Hajjaj, and Samir al-Rifai – and injured four others, including Qalajah, Imad Daloul, Imam Badr, and Mahmoud al-Ghazi. With Qalajah's death, the total number of journalists and media workers martyred since the start of the aggression on the Gaza Strip on October 7, 2023, has risen to 226. Israeli enemy forces arrest four Palestinians, including three women, in Nablus, young man from al-Quds in town of al-Ram

Ramallah/Occupied al-Quds- Saba: Israeli enemy forces arrested four Palestinian citizens, including three women, from the Nablus governorate in the West Bank at dawn on Friday. The Palestinian Wafa News Agency reported that Israeli enemy forces stormed the village of Beit Iba, west of Nablus, and arrested a woman and her daughter after raiding and searching the family's home. The same sources added that Israeli jeeps stormed the village of Zawata to the west, raided and arrested a man and his wife, after searching the house and ransacking its contents. In Ramallah, Israeli enemy forces stormed the village of Kafr Malik, northeast of Ramallah, at dawn on Friday. The Palestinian Wafa News Agency reported that a large military force stormed the village of Kafr Malik and raided several homes, all of which belonged to released prisoners. The raids included extensive vandalism of the homes, destruction of furniture, the theft of cash and gold jewelry, and the seizure of vehicles. In occupied al-Quds, Israeli occupation forces arrested a Palestinian young man from the town of al-Ram, north of al-Quds, on Friday.
